About the Journal of Geochemical Exploration format
Journal of Geochemical Exploration is a peer-reviewed journal published by Elsevier, covering Geochemistry and Geologic Mapping, Geological and Geochemical Analysis, Heavy metals in environment.

What reference style does Journal of Geochemical Exploration use?
Journal of Geochemical Exploration uses Author–year (Harvard) references, shown as author–year markers such as (Smith, 2023) in the text. DocuGuru formats every in-text citation and the reference list in this exact style automatically. A reference appears like this: Smith, A., Jones, B. and Lee, C. (2023) 'A representative article title', Journal of Geochemical Exploration, 12(3), pp. 45–58.
